Warning Signs You Need Antimicrobial Treatment Services
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ems down the line. Don’t ignore these warning signs: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, persistent musty odors can show the presence of mold and bacteria. If you notice these smells, it’s essential to investigate the source and take action quickly.
Visible Mold Growth
Black or greenish patches on walls, ceilings, or floors are a clear indication of mold growth. Don’t delay in addressing this issue, as it can spread quickly and cause serious health risks.
Water Damage and Leaks
Visible water damage, such as warping, discoloration, or mineral deposits, can show a more extensive issue. Leaks, no matter how small, can lead to significant microbial growth and property damage.
Health Issues and Allergies
If you or your family members are experiencing health issues, such as respiratory problems, allergies, or skin irritation, it may be linked to microbial growth in your home. Addressing this issue quickly can help alleviate symptoms and prevent further health risks.
Unexplained Stains and Discoloration
Unexplained stains or discoloration on walls, ceilings, or floors can be a sign of microbial growth. Investigate the source and take action to prevent further damage.
Increased Humidity and Moisture
High humidity levels can create an ideal environment for microbial growth. If you notice increased moisture or humidity in your home, take steps to address it quickly to prevent further issues.

Antimicrobial Treatment Services Cost In Foxborough, MA
The cost of Antimicrobial Treatment Services can vary based on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ates are based on our extensive experience in the area and our commitment to providing the best possible service at a fair price. Please note that prices may fluctuate depending on the specific needs of your property.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and Inspection | $200 – $500 | Size and complexity of the affected area, severity of microbial growth |
| Treatment and Cleaning | $1,000 – $3,000 | Size and complexity of the affected area, type and extent of microbial growth |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$500 – $1,500 | Size and complexity of the affected area, duration of drying and dehumidification process |
| Restoration and Repair | $2,000 – $6,000 | Size and complexity of the affected area, type and extent of damage, materials and labor required |
